Subject: DR drill Thursday — metrics sidecar

Plugin authors: Thursday we run a disaster-recovery drill on the Copperfen metrics-aggregation sidecar. Expect the aggregation endpoint to go dark for up to 20 minutes; buffer locally and replay after. Do not file incidents during the window. Plugins needing the standby aggregator must authenticate manually during the drill, using the recovery passphrase that appears below.

unlock words, kawig-bawef: belax-sorir-druax-ulaiel-wenael-belael

Q3 Planning Note — Thornquist Franchise Deal

Heads of department: quick update. The franchise agreement with Thornquist Provisions is nearly wrapped — legal's doing a final pass this week. They'll run three locations in the Dunmore corridor under our Copperleaf brand. We supply inventory and systems; they cover fit-out and staffing. Budget owners, flag any onboarding costs by the 15th so we can fold them into Q3. Context on where this fits strategically is below.

board note of tadup-tajog: Headcount on the Oliiel team goes from 31 to 88 by the end of February. Gross margin on Oliiel came in at 62 percent against a plan of 29 percent.

Subject: Heads up — the new Solara Premium tier

Hi team,

Quick one for the sales leads: we're launching Solara Premium next quarter, sitting above Solara Pro with priority support, the analytics add-on baked in, and annual-only billing. Early access goes to our top fifty accounts first, so start flagging candidates now. Pricing decks land in your inboxes Friday — please don't share externally yet. The confidential strategy note is right below.

management briefing: Jorixax Holdings is in early talks to buy Casixax Holdings for about $420.3 million. The Fenmir launch date is October 27, and nothing goes to the press before then. Legal wants the Keloxek Foods term sheet redrafted before April 16.

Quick briefing ahead of the leadership review: we're switching logistics from Drayfell Carriers to Moxton Freight at the start of next quarter. Drivers: better regional coverage and roughly 9% lower cost per pallet. Transition plan runs six weeks, with overlap to avoid missed deliveries. Heads of department, flag any blockers this week. Some context stays internal.

board note of bawep-tajef: Queniusek Systems plans to raise the Quenvan list price by 53.1 percent in March. The pricing group signed off on a budget of $176.4 million for Project Drueth. The renewal with Casionix Partners closes at $142.5 million a year, 8.3 percent below the last contract. Project Fraax slips by six weeks because of the tooling delay.